Output 612090e6371b95d7701369721e4a22d69f33bf7956274a2d7a37089a81c2aac1:1

value
39454881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1fd86b024162ff8a66e4105e626e88d0d4bbfe1 OP_EQUAL
address
3NHwg1WXZVh5TxhEMoxFBDUNkz4BtrHBMC
transaction
612090e6371b95d7701369721e4a22d69f33bf7956274a2d7a37089a81c2aac1